Cesspool cleaning services involve the removal of waste and sludge that accumulate in underground cesspools, which are large underground tanks used for the collection and storage of sewage and wastewater. These services typically include pumping out the contents of the cesspool, inspecting the tank for any signs of damage or deterioration, and ensuring the system is functioning properly. Regular cleaning helps prevent the buildup of solids that can cause blockages, backups, and unpleasant odors, contributing to the overall sanitation and safety of a property’s sewage management system.

Many common problems associated with neglected cesspools can be mitigated through professional cleaning services. Over time, solids and debris can accumulate, leading to clogs that may result in sewage backups or overflows. These issues can pose health hazards and cause property damage if not addressed promptly. Additionally, a poorly maintained cesspool can emit foul odors that affect the comfort of a property’s occupants and nearby neighbors. Routine cleaning and maintenance help identify potential issues early, reducing the risk of costly repairs and ensuring the system remains operational.

Cesspool cleaning services are often utilized by homeowners, property managers, and business owners who operate properties without access to municipal sewage systems. This includes rural residences, commercial properties, and certain multi-unit buildings where cesspools serve as the primary wastewater disposal method. These services are essential for maintaining compliance with local health and safety standards, as well as ensuring the proper functioning of the property’s sewage system. Regular cleaning schedules can help prevent emergency situations and extend the lifespan of the cesspool infrastructure.

Service Costs - Typical costs for cesspool cleaning services range from $300 to $600, depending on the size of the tank and local rates. Larger tanks or difficult access may increase the price beyond this range.

Pricing Factors - The cost can vary based on factors such as tank location, condition, and the need for additional services like inspection or repairs. Expect to pay more for complex or emergency cleanings.

Average Expenses - On average, homeowners in Redwood City and nearby areas spend around $400 for standard cesspool cleaning. Prices may fluctuate based on the service provider and specific job requirements.

Cost Variations - Costs can vary across different local service providers, with some charging as low as $250 and others up to $700 for comprehensive cleaning. It’s recommended to contact multiple pros for accurate estimates.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

How often should I have my cesspool cleaned? The frequency of cesspool cleaning depends on usage and tank size, but generally, it is recommended every 3 to 5 years. Contact local service providers to determine the best schedule for your property.

What are signs that my cesspool needs cleaning? Signs include slow draining fixtures, unpleasant odors, or standing water near the tank. Consulting a local professional can help assess whether cleaning is needed.

Is cesspool cleaning harmful to the environment? Professional cesspool cleaning is typically performed with proper equipment and disposal methods to minimize environmental impact. Contact local pros to learn more about their practices.

How long does cesspool cleaning usually take? The duration varies based on tank size and condition, but most services can be completed within a few hours. Local service providers can provide more specific estimates.

Can I perform cesspool cleaning myself? Cesspool cleaning involves specialized equipment and safety precautions, so it is recommended to hire trained professionals for the job. Contact local contractors to arrange service.
